Creating a Google Cloud Platform Project
To start your journey with Google Cloud Platform, the initial step entails establishing a project. This action serves as a container for all your resources and services within GCP. Accessing the Cloud Console is paramount to this process. Navigate to the "Projects" page, then choose "New Project." Input a unique project name that adheres to naming conventions. Specify the desired location for your resources and review the terms of service before proceeding with the creation.
Once your project is operational, you'll be presented with a overview that provides a centralized view of your GCP resources. From here, you can explore various services, modify settings, and instantiate applications. Remember to fortify your project by implementing appropriate access controls and tracking resource usage for optimal performance and cost management.
Install and Customize Google Cloud SDK
To begin your journey with Google Cloud Platform, you'll need to download and deploy the Google Cloud SDK. This powerful package of command-line tools enables you to control with various GCP resources. Once installed, customize the SDK to align your configuration and needs. You can define your primary project, configure authentication methods, and install specific modules as needed.
- Refer to the official Google Cloud documentation for detailed guidance on installing and customizing the SDK.
- Leverage the `gcloud` command-line interface to interact with your GCP resources after setup.
